Is it possible to purchase digital currencies using Venmo?
I am wondering if it is possible to buy digital currencies using Venmo. I have heard that Venmo is a popular payment app, but I'm not sure if it supports cryptocurrency transactions. Can I use Venmo to purchase Bitcoin, Ethereum, or other digital currencies? Are there any limitations or restrictions when using Venmo for cryptocurrency transactions?
5 answers
- Ajit LendeFeb 01, 2023 · 3 years agoYes, it is possible to purchase digital currencies using Venmo. Venmo has recently started allowing users to buy, sell, and hold cryptocurrencies directly within the app. You can now use Venmo to purchase Bitcoin, Ethereum, and other popular digital currencies. However, it's important to note that Venmo's cryptocurrency feature is currently only available to eligible customers in certain states. Additionally, there may be limitations on the amount you can buy or sell using Venmo. It's always a good idea to check Venmo's official website or contact their customer support for the most up-to-date information.
